The Lost Southern Chefs: A History of Commercial Dining in the Nineteenth-Century South
Robert F. Moss
Moss describes the economic forces and technological advances that revolutionized public dining, reshaped commercial pantries, and gave southerners who loved to eat a wealth of restaurants, hotel dining rooms, oyster houses, confectionery stores, and saloons.
